With two feature films in this year’s Festival, Love and Savagery and The Trotsky, nominated for the
CFTPA Producer of the Year Award, producer and co-writer of Bon Cop Bad Cop, the highest grossing
Canadian movie in domestic box office history and Genie winner for Best Film of 2006, and producer
of television productions that have been nominated for a total of 11 Emmys and 12 Geminis, Kevin
is the perfect guest to celebrate at this year’s event. Host Wayne Grigsby asks the questions that will
tap into this high energy, thoroughly entertaining Canadian producer of award winning film and television.
